About this listen

Return to the world of Rivers of London in this first short-story collection from number one Sunday Times best-selling author Ben Aaronovitch. Tales from the Folly is a carefully curated collection that gathers together previously published stories and brand new tales in the same place for the first time.

Each tale features a new introduction from the author, filled with insight and anecdote offering the listener a deeper exploration into this absorbing fictional world. This is a must-listen for any Rivers of London fan.

Join Peter, Nightingale, Abigail, Agent Reynolds and Tobias Winter for a series of perfectly portioned tales. Discover what's haunting a lonely motorway service station, who still wanders the shelves of a popular London bookshop and what exactly happened to the River Lugg.

With an introduction from internationally best-selling author of the Sookie Stackhouse series, Charlaine Harris.

This collection includes:

  • 'The Home Crowd Advantage'
  • 'The Domestic'
  • 'The Cockpit'
  • 'The Loneliness of the Long-Distance Granny'
  • 'King of the Rats'
  • 'A Rare Book of Cunning Device'
  • 'A Dedicated Follower of Fashion'
  • 'Favourite Uncle'
  • 'Vanessa Sommer's Other Christmas List'
  • 'Three Rivers, Two Husbands and a Baby'
  • 'Moments One, Two and Three'
